Health services are on the verge of collapse – GMOA

0

The Government Medical Officers’ Association (GMOA) says that there is a severe shortage of medicines and medical equipment in almost all hospitals today.

Dr. Sonal Fernando, Secretary of the Government Medical Officers ‘Association (GMOA) said that due to severe shortages of medicines and medical equipment, power cuts, and fuel shortages, hospitals’ essential patient care services have been disrupted and the entire healthcare system will be disrupted in the future.

He also said that the health service is collapsing due to not giving priority to the free health service which is maintained by the people’s tax money.

Dr. Fernando said that the government has an inalienable responsibility to ensure the right to life and health of the people and that the present government and the Ministry of Health have failed to uphold that fundamental right.

He said the supply of medicines and equipment was the sole responsibility of the government and the Ministry of Health, but that patient care services had almost completely collapsed due to the economic crisis caused by poor financial management.
